2014 Kia Venga — MOT failures & pass rate
Across 32,730 MOT tests, the 2014 Kia Venga recorded an 82.0% pass rate. MPVs of a similar age fail 19.1% of the time, so this is 1.1pp better than the group it competes with. Failures cluster in lighting & signalling, steering and brakes.
What the MOT record shows
No single area dominates — lighting & signalling (9.7%) and steering (7.0%) are close, so failures are spread across several systems rather than one weak point.
At component level the recurring items are track rod end, position lamp and ball joint dust cover — track rod end alone was recorded 2,599 times.
Condition tracks the odometer closely. Failures run at 7.9% in the 0-30k band and 32.7% in the 150k+ band, a 24.8-point spread — more than double.
Split by fuel, diesel examples fail 4.0pp more often than petrol ones (20.8% vs 16.8%) — worth weighing if you have a choice.
Advisories point at the next bill rather than this one: tyres was flagged on 24.9% of tests without failing them.
The trend is worsening — 12.0% of tests failed in 2021 against 22.6% in 2025, the usual pattern as a fleet ages.

Top failure categories
| # | Category | % of tests affected | Tests |
|---|---|---|---|
| 1 | Lighting & signalling | 9.7% | 3,161 |
| 2 | Steering | 7.0% | 2,306 |
| 3 | Brakes | 4.5% | 1,471 |
| 4 | Suspension | 4.4% | 1,438 |
| 5 | Tyres | 4.1% | 1,355 |
| 6 | Visibility | 3.4% | 1,104 |
Most common specific failures
The exact components most often recorded as failures — more specific than the categories above.
| # | Failure item | Times recorded |
|---|---|---|
| 1 | Track rod end | 2,599 |
| 2 | Position lamp | 1,796 |
| 3 | Ball joint dust cover | 874 |
| 4 | Headlamp aim | 837 |
| 5 | Washers | 789 |
| 6 | Brake pads | 730 |

Failure rate by mileage
Higher-mileage cars tend to fail more — often the most useful guide to real condition.
| Mileage band | Tests | Fail rate |
|---|---|---|
| 0-30k | 5,062 | 7.9% |
| 30-60k | 15,702 | 16.2% |
| 60-90k | 8,768 | 23.3% |
| 90-120k | 2,527 | 28.5% |
| 120-150k | 520 | 28.8% |
| 150k+ | 150 | 32.7% |

What to check before buying a 2014 Venga
On a 2014 Venga, lighting & signalling is what the MOT record says goes wrong most — it appeared in 9.7% of tests. Check these areas before you commit.
- Lighting & signalling (9.7% of tests): Often a cheap bulb, but persistent issues can mean wiring or corrosion in the units. Typical repair: £10–£150.
- Steering (7.0% of tests): Play, leaks or worn track rod ends — affects handling and is a safety item. Typical repair: £150–£500.
- Brakes (4.5% of tests): Pads/discs are routine wear; binding, imbalance or corroded pipes are more serious — test for pulling under braking. Typical repair: £100–£350 per axle.
Repair costs are rough UK ballpark ranges to set expectations, not quotes — actual prices vary widely by car, parts and garage.
